What companies run services between Cobble Hill, NY, USA and Citi Field, NY, USA?

You can take a subway from Bergen St to Citi Field via Court Sq and Mets-Willets Point in around 47 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Adams St/Brooklyn Supreme Court to Citi Field via Palmetto St/Saint Nicholas Av and 41 Rd/College Point Blvd in around 2h 2m.
